Output 52f881e0082c12a00d71c5662f0285dbb20baa53ff50be13af88e1c41f27071b:0

value
591058
script pubkey
OP_0 OP_PUSHBYTES_20 bafbfe770cbbae99e80ef9adffe31bf139a97c15
address
bc1qhtaluacvhwhfn6qwlxkllccm7yu6jlq44nkpqs
transaction
52f881e0082c12a00d71c5662f0285dbb20baa53ff50be13af88e1c41f27071b